-Engage Cover Ceremony-

The bride's niece served as the ring bearer

"Engagement Cover Ceremony" where engagement rings and wedding rings are stacked together

"Engage" means engagement, and "cover" means to conceal or envelop.

"Ring" means a finger ring.

It has the meaning of sealing the eternal love sworn with a wedding ring.
